: Could you please help with the following problem: A picture 9 inches wide and 12 inches long is surrounded by a frame of uniform width. The area of the frame only is 162 square inches. Find the width of the frame.

Draw the picture of the frame around the picture.
----------------------------
Let the width of the frame be "x"inches.
-----------------------------
Area of picture with frame around is length*width
Width = 9 + 2x inches
length = 12 + 2x inches
---------
Larger area = (9+2x)(12+2x)
=2(9+2x)(6+x)
=2[54+21x+2x^2]
=4x^2 + 42x + 108
---------------
Area of frame = larger area - 9*12
= 4x^2 + 42x +108 - 108
= 4x^2 + 42x
-------------------
Area of frame = 162 sq. in.
4x^2+42x= 162
2x^2 + 21x -81 = 0
x = [-21+33]/4 = 3 or x = [-21-33]/4 = -54/4 = -27/2
----------------------
Realistic Answer: width = 3 inches
